- 1915 John Bunny
Silent film comedian (born 1863)
- 1931 George Mead
Influential pragmatist philosopher and sociologist.
- 1940 Carl Bosch
CHE - German chemist and engineer, nobel prize laureate (b. 1874)
- 1951 Arnold Sommerfeld
German physicist, whose atomic model allowed the explanation of fine structure spectral lines.
- 1956 Edward Arnold
Actor (mr smith goes to washington), is killed at 66
- 1961 Gail Russell
American actress known for her roles in Hollywood films during the 1940s and 1950s, with a tragic personal life marked by alcoholism.
- 1973 Irene Ryan
Beloved actress best known for her iconic role as Granny in the popular TV sitcom 'The Beverly Hillbillies', a comedy series that ran from 1962 to 1971.
- 1976 Sidney James
Actor (lavander hills mob, carry on), dies at 65
- 1980 Cicely Courtneidge
Australian-born british actress, comedian and singer (b. 1893)

- 1984 May McAvoy
Actress ben hur dies at 82 following a heart attack
- 1984 Count Basie
Legendary jazz pianist, composer, and bandleader who led the iconic Count Basie Orchestra, revolutionizing big band and swing music in the 20th century.
- 1986 Broderick Crawford
Broderick Crawford was an acclaimed American actor best known for his Oscar-winning role in 'All the King's Men' and his starring role in the popular TV series 'Highway Patrol'.
- 1986 Bessie Love
Actress (broadway melody and isadora), is killed at 87
- 1987 Shankar (director)
Shankar is a renowned Tamil cinema director famous for his visually spectacular and technologically innovative films, significantly influencing Indian cinema.
- 1989 Lucille Ball
Iconic American actress and comedian who revolutionized television comedy through her groundbreaking sitcom 'I Love Lucy'. She was a pioneering female television producer and one of the most influential entertainers of the 20th century. Her trademark fiery red hair and comedic genius made her a beloved cultural icon.
- 1994 Masutatsu Ōyama
Legendary Japanese martial artist who founded Kyokushin Karate, a full-contact karate style known worldwide for its intense training and philosophy.
- 1995 Alexander Knox
Canadian-English actor and screenwriter known for his versatile performances in film and theater during the mid-20th century.
- 1996 Stirling Silliphant
Renowned American screenwriter and producer known for his significant contributions to film and television, including Academy Award-winning work.
- 1999 Jill Dando
Beloved British television presenter and journalist tragically murdered in 1999, whose death shocked the nation.
- 2003 Rosemary Brown
Pioneering Canadian politician and social worker who broke racial barriers by becoming the first Black woman elected to a provincial legislature in Canada, representing British Columbia's New Democratic Party.
- 2004 Hubert Selby
American author, poet, and screenwriter known for his gritty, raw literary style and influential works exploring urban life and human struggles.
- 2005 Maria Schell
Maria Schell was a renowned Austrian-Swiss actress and film producer who had a significant career in European cinema during the mid-20th century. She was known for her powerful performances in international films and won numerous awards for her acting. Her career spanned several decades, making her a prominent figure in post-war European cinema.
- 2005 Augusto Roa Bastos
Renowned Paraguayan novelist and intellectual who significantly contributed to Latin American literature, best known for his novel 'I, the Supreme'.
- 2013 George Jones
Legendary country music singer-songwriter known as the 'King of Honky Tonk' and one of the most influential artists in country music history.
- 2015 Jayne Meadows
American actress known for her work in television and film, wife of comedian Steve Allen and notable performer in productions like 'Dark Delusion'.
- 2016 Harry Wu
Prominent Chinese human rights activist who dedicated his life to exposing human rights abuses in China, particularly in labor camps.
- 2017 Jonathan Demme
Jonathan Demme was an acclaimed American filmmaker known for directing groundbreaking films like The Silence of the Lambs, Philadelphia, and Rachel Getting Married. He was a critically respected director who won an Academy Award for The Silence of the Lambs.
